Quick Answer
Prevent contamination by using proper well construction techniques, avoiding nearby pollution sources, and regularly monitoring water quality. This includes using a well casing, screen, and cap to protect the water from surface contaminants.
Selecting a Safe Location
When digging a well, it’s essential to choose a location that minimizes the risk of contamination. This typically means avoiding areas with nearby septic systems, agricultural runoff, or other potential pollution sources. A safe distance of at least 100 feet from these sources is recommended. Additionally, the well should be located in an area with a moderate to high water table to reduce the likelihood of contaminated surface water seeping into the well. A thorough soil investigation can help identify the optimal location.
Well Construction Techniques
A well constructed using proper techniques can significantly reduce the risk of contamination. The well casing should be made of a durable, corrosion-resistant material such as PVC or steel, and should extend at least 12 inches below the water table. A well screen with a mesh size of 1/4 inch or smaller should be installed to allow water to flow into the well while keeping larger particles out. The well cap should be fitted with a seal to prevent surface contamination from entering the well.
Regular Maintenance and Monitoring
Regular maintenance and monitoring are crucial to preventing well contamination. The well should be regularly inspected for signs of contamination, such as changes in water taste, odor, or color. Water samples should be taken and analyzed for bacteria, nitrates, and other contaminants at least once a year. Additionally, the well should be disinfected annually to prevent bacterial growth and contamination. By following these best practices, the risk of well contamination can be significantly reduced.
